Non-volatile memory with source-side column select
    1.
    发明授权
    Non-volatile memory with source-side column select 有权
    源极列选择非易失性存储器

    公开(公告)号:US07522453B1

    公开(公告)日:2009-04-21

    申请号:US11961134

    申请日:2007-12-20

    IPC分类号: G11C16/04

    CPC分类号: G11C16/0416 G11C16/08

    摘要: A non-volatile memory array segment includes an odd-select transistor having a drain coupled to an odd-source line and an even-select transistor having a drain coupled to an even-source line. Two segment-select transistors have drains coupled to the sources of different ones of the odd and even source lines, sources coupled to ground, and gates coupled to a segment-select line. A plurality of odd non-volatile memory transistors each has a drain coupled to a common drain line, a source coupled to the odd-source line, a floating gate, and a control gate. A plurality of even non-volatile memory transistors, each has a drain coupled to the common drain line, a source coupled to the even-source line, a floating gate, and a control gate. The control gate of each even non-volatile memory transistor is coupled to the control gate of a different one of the odd non-volatile memory transistors.

    摘要翻译: 非易失性存储器阵列段包括具有耦合到奇数源极线的漏极和耦合到偶数源极线的漏极的偶数选择晶体管的奇数选择晶体管。 两个段选择晶体管具有耦合到奇数和偶数源极线的不同源极,耦合到地的源极和耦合到段选择线的栅极的漏极。 多个奇数非易失性存储晶体管各自具有耦合到公共漏极线的漏极,耦合到奇数源极线的源极,浮动栅极和控制栅极。 多个偶数非易失性存储晶体管每个都具有耦合到公共漏极线的漏极,耦合到偶数源极线的源极,浮动栅极和控制栅极。 每个偶数非易失性存储晶体管的控制栅极耦合到奇数非易失性存储晶体管中不同一个的控制栅极。

    PLD PROVIDING SOFT WAKEUP LOGIC
    2.
    发明申请
    PLD PROVIDING SOFT WAKEUP LOGIC 有权
    PLD提供软件唤醒逻辑

    公开(公告)号:US20100156457A1

    公开(公告)日:2010-06-24

    申请号:US12340358

    申请日:2008-12-19

    IPC分类号: H03K19/177 H03K19/0175

    CPC分类号: H03K19/17784

    摘要: A programmable logic device (PLD) with a plurality of programmable regions is disclosed. Some of the programmable regions have switch power or ground supplies to allow them to be put into a low-power state in one or more low-power modes. At least one of the programmable regions always remains on during the low-power modes to enable the user to design custom PLD power management logic that may be placed in the always-on programmable region.

    摘要翻译: 公开了具有多个可编程区域的可编程逻辑器件(PLD)。 一些可编程区域具有开关电源或接地电源,以允许它们在一个或多个低功率模式下进入低功率状态。 在低功率模式期间,至少一个可编程区域始终保持接通状态,以使用户能够设计定制的PLD功率管理逻辑,该逻辑可以放置在永久可编程区域中。

    PLD providing soft wakeup logic
    3.
    发明授权
    PLD providing soft wakeup logic 有权
    PLD提供软唤醒逻辑

    公开(公告)号:US07884640B2

    公开(公告)日:2011-02-08

    申请号:US12340358

    申请日:2008-12-19

    IPC分类号: H03K19/173

    CPC分类号: H03K19/17784

    摘要: A programmable logic device (PLD) with a plurality of programmable regions is disclosed. Some of the programmable regions have switch power or ground supplies to allow them to be put into a low-power state in one or more low-power modes. At least one of the programmable regions always remains on during the low-power modes to enable the user to design custom PLD power management logic that may be placed in the always-on programmable region.

    摘要翻译: 公开了具有多个可编程区域的可编程逻辑器件(PLD)。 一些可编程区域具有开关电源或接地电源,以允许它们在一个或多个低功率模式下进入低功率状态。 在低功率模式期间,至少一个可编程区域始终保持接通状态,以使用户能够设计定制的PLD功率管理逻辑,该逻辑可以放置在永久可编程区域中。

    Error-detecting and correcting FPGA architecture
    4.
    发明授权
    Error-detecting and correcting FPGA architecture 有权
    错误检测和校正FPGA架构

    公开(公告)号:US07937647B2

    公开(公告)日:2011-05-03

    申请号:US11829335

    申请日:2007-07-27

    IPC分类号: G11C29/00 H03M13/00

    摘要: A method and apparatus are provided for an error-correcting FPGA. ECC data for configuration is generated and programmed into the ECC rows in the configuration memory. While booting, it is determined whether an integrity-check bit is set. If so, an integrity check is performed. If a single-bit error is detected, if the bit error is an erroneous “0” value, the memory location containing the erroneous “0” value is reprogrammed to a “1” value. If the bit error is an erroneous “1,” value, the memory block data is saved in a non-volatile memory block, the configuration memory block containing the error is erased and reprogrammed using the corrected bit. If there is more than one error, an error flag is set. The user reads the status of the error flag through the JTAG port. If the error flag is set then a full reprogramming cycle is initiated.

    摘要翻译: 提供了用于纠错FPGA的方法和装置。 生成用于配置的ECC数据并将其编程到配置存储器中的ECC行中。 在引导时,确定是否设置完整性校验位。 如果是这样,则执行完整性检查。 如果检测到单位错误,如果位错误是错误的“0”值,则包含错误“0”值的存储器位置被重新编程为“1”值。 如果位错误是错误的“1”值,则存储器块数据被保存在非易失性存储器块中,包含该错误的配置存储器块被擦除并且使用校正位被重新编程。 如果存在多个错误,则设置错误标志。 用户通过JTAG端口读取错误标志的状态。 如果设置了错误标志,则启动完整的重新编程周期。

    Power-up and power-down circuit for system-on-a-chip integrated circuit
    5.
    发明授权
    Power-up and power-down circuit for system-on-a-chip integrated circuit 有权
    用于片上系统集成电路的上电和掉电电路

    公开(公告)号:US07911226B2

    公开(公告)日:2011-03-22

    申请号:US11467279

    申请日:2006-08-25

    申请人: Gregory Bakker

    发明人: Gregory Bakker

    IPC分类号: H03K19/173 G05F1/00 G05F5/00

    摘要: A power-up and power-down circuit for an integrated circuit includes a voltage regulator set for a first voltage. A first I/O pad is coupled internally to an input to the voltage regulator and to first internal circuits. The second voltage is externally coupled to the first I/O pad. A second I/O pad is coupled internally to an output of the voltage regulator configured to drive the base of an external transistor. A third I/O pad of the integrated circuit is coupled internally to a reference-voltage input of the voltage regulator. A fourth I/O pad is coupled to a feedback input of the voltage regulator. A fifth I/O pad of the integrated circuit is coupled internally to logic circuitry that controls power-up and power down of the integrated circuit from internal signals including internal signals from a real-time clock circuit disposed on the integrated circuit.

    摘要翻译: 用于集成电路的上电和掉电电路包括用于第一电压的电压调节器。 第一个I / O焊盘内部耦合到电压调节器和第一个内部电路的输入端。 第二电压外部耦合到第一I / O焊盘。 第二I / O焊盘内部耦合到被配置为驱动外部晶体管的基极的电压调节器的输出端。 集成电路的第三个I / O焊盘内部耦合到电压调节器的参考电压输入端。 第四I / O焊盘耦合到电压调节器的反馈输入端。 集成电路的第五个I / O焊盘内部耦合到逻辑电路,该逻辑电路从包括设置在集成电路上的实时时钟电路的内部信号的内部信号控制集成电路的上电和掉电。

    Programmable logic device with a microcontroller-based control system
    6.
    发明授权
    Programmable logic device with a microcontroller-based control system 有权
    可编程逻辑器件,具有基于微控制器的控制系统

    公开(公告)号:US07683660B1

    公开(公告)日:2010-03-23

    申请号:US12023299

    申请日:2008-01-31

    IPC分类号: H03K19/173

    CPC分类号: H03K19/1733 G06F17/5054

    摘要: A computer program product in a computer-readable medium for use in a microcontroller-based control system in a programmable logic integrated circuit device is disclosed. The computer program product comprises first instructions for initializing the device, second instructions for reading programming data from a data source external to the programmable logic integrated circuit device, third instructions for transferring the programming data into control elements internal to the programmable logic integrated circuit device. Provision is made for fourth instructions for saving at least a part of the internal logic state of the user logic programmed into the programmable logic integrated circuit device into a non-volatile memory block and for fifth instructions for restoring at least a part of the internal logic state of the user logic programmed into the programmable logic integrated circuit device from a non-volatile memory block. The programmable logic integrated circuit device, comprises a microcontroller block and a programmable logic block with programming circuitry, and has a sub-bus which couples the microcontroller block to the programming circuitry.

    摘要翻译: 公开了一种用于可编程逻辑集成电路装置中基于微控制器的控制系统的计算机可读介质中的计算机程序产品。 计算机程序产品包括用于初始化设备的第一指令,用于从可编程逻辑集成电路器件外部的数据源读取编程数据的第二指令,用于将编程数据传送到可编程逻辑集成电路器件内部的控制元件的第三指令。 规定了第四条指令,用于将编程到可编程逻辑集成电路设备中的用户逻辑的内部逻辑状态的至少一部分保存到非易失性存储器块中,以及用于恢复内部逻辑的至少一部分的第五指令 从非易失性存储器块编程到可编程逻辑集成电路器件中的用户逻辑状态。 可编程逻辑集成电路器件包括微控制器模块和具有编程电路的可编程逻辑模块,并且具有将微控制器模块耦合到编程电路的子总线。

    VOLTAGE- AND TEMPERATURE-COMPENSATED RC OSCILLATOR CIRCUIT
    10.
    发明申请
    VOLTAGE- AND TEMPERATURE-COMPENSATED RC OSCILLATOR CIRCUIT 审中-公开
    电压和温度补偿RC振荡器电路

    公开(公告)号:US20080284532A1

    公开(公告)日:2008-11-20

    申请号:US12182329

    申请日:2008-07-30

    申请人: Gregory Bakker

    发明人: Gregory Bakker

    摘要: An integrated temperature-compensated RC oscillator circuit includes an inverter having an input and an output. An RC network is coupled between the inverter and a pair of comparators. A first comparator has an inverting input coupled to a first reference voltage, a non-inverting input coupled to the RC network, and an output. A second comparator has an inverting input coupled to the RC network, a non-inverting input coupled to a second reference voltage, and an output. A set-reset flip-flop has a set input coupled to the output of the first comparator, a reset input coupled to the output of the second comparator, and an output coupled to the input of the inverter. Differential amplifiers in the comparators each have a diode-connected p-channel MOS transistor controlling a mirrored p-channel MOS transistor whose channel width is less than that of the diode-connected p-channel current mirror transistor.

    摘要翻译: 集成温度补偿RC振荡器电路包括具有输入和输出的反相器。 RC网络耦合在逆变器和一对比较器之间。 第一比较器具有耦合到第一参考电压的反相输入,耦合到RC网络的非反相输入和输出。 第二比较器具有耦合到RC网络的反相输入,耦合到第二参考电压的非反相输入和输出。 设置复位触发器具有耦合到第一比较器的输出的设置输入,耦合到第二比较器的输出的复位输入和耦合到反相器的输入的输出。 比较器中的差分放大器各自具有二极管连接的p沟道MOS晶体管,其控制沟道宽度小于二极管连接的p沟道电流镜晶体管的p沟道MOS晶体管。